Ofsted stopped awarding single-word overall grades in September 2024. This grade is 3 years old and will not be updated — the school keeps it until its next inspection, which will not produce a replacement grade.

On the headline measure this school is in the bottom quarter of state-funded primaries in England.

Compared with the fifth of schools whose intake is most disadvantaged, which is where this one sits, it is in the lower half.

There are no progress measures for primary schools any more. They were calculated from a key stage 1 baseline, and statutory key stage 1 tests ended in 2023, so nothing has been published since. That makes attainment the only official measure — and attainment tracks intake closely, which is why the comparison against similar schools above is the more useful of the two lines.
